The STAAR…replacing the TAKS!

Beginning in spring 2012, students will start a new voyage with the launch of the next testing program, called the State of Texas Assessments of Academic Readiness or STAAR™.

What is STAAR?

STAAR is a more rigorous standardized testing program that will replace the Texas Assessment of Knowledge and Skills (TAKS) for elementary, middle school, and high school students. The new STAAR program will emphasize “readiness” standards, which are the knowledge and skills that are considered most important for success in the grade or subject that follows and for college and career.

    Judges and volunteers are needed for the Austin Energy Regional Science Festival

    Judges and volunteers are needed for the Austin Energy Regional Science Festival coming up in February at the Palmer Events Center. This is a great opportunity for people interested in meeting the next generation of young scientists from Central Texas.
    The Austin Energy Regional Science Festival is among the largest of the 20 regional science fairs held in Texas. More than 3,500 elementary, middle and high school students and their families attend each year.
    The festival offers a public viewing of the science projects, educational booths and scientific demonstrations for the kids. It is a valuable way to support our community by investing in our most important resource, our future.
    Annually, we need approximately 200 general volunteers plus 200 judges for the Elementary Division and about 350 judges for the Junior (middle school) and Senior (high school) divisions.

    Harmony Public Schools – Austin Proclamation

    Harmony Public Schools in Austin were honored by the City of Austin and Mayor, Lee Leffingwell last night at the January 12th City Council Meeting. Mayor Leffingwell announced a Proclamation declaring Harmony Public Schools Week to be January 13 – 20, 2012. Clearly all the hard work and dedication that each and every student, staff, teacher, administrator and parent has put into making our schools successful has paid off.     To The Attention of Prospective Parents

    Dear Prospective Students/Parents,

    As enrollment season approaches, we would like to share a couple of reminders with you.

    1 - The application period for Harmony Public Schools is between January 10 and March 15 for the 2012-2013 school year.
    2 - All applications prior to January 10, 2012 will be considered for the 2011-2012 school year.
    3 - Any application received after March 15, 2012 will be placed on the waiting list in the order of the date in which the application is received.
    4 - The Lottery will be drawn during the last week of March 2012.
    5 – Selected students will be announced by the end of the 1st week of April 2012.

    Please note that any application received is only considered for one school year. If your child is not selected for enrollment, a new application must be submitted for each year.
